hu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]Keepalived高可用集群部署实践指南|高可用集群搭建详细步骤,keepalived高可用集群部署

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文介绍了Linux操作系统下Keepalived高可用集群的部署实践,详细阐述了高可用集群的搭建步骤。通过逐步解析,展示了如何利用Keepalived实现服务的故障转移和负载均衡,确保系统稳定运行。

本文目录导读:

  1. Keepalived简介
  2. 部署环境
  3. 部署步骤
  4. 注意事项

随着信息技术的快速发展,企业对于业务系统的稳定性和可靠性要求越来越高,高可用集群部署成为保障业务连续性的重要手段,本文将详细介绍如何使用Keepalived实现高可用集群的部署,帮助读者掌握这一技术。

Keepalived简介

Keepalived是一个基于VRRP(Virtual Router Redundancy Protocol)的高可用性解决方案,它通过虚拟路由冗余协议,在多台服务器之间实现虚拟路由器的备份,从而确保网络服务的持续可用性,Keepalived适用于各种场景,如数据库、Web服务器、文件服务器等。

部署环境

1、硬件环境:至少两台服务器,配置相同,确保网络连接正常。

2、软件环境:操作系统建议使用Linux,本文以CentOS 7为例。

3、网络环境:确保所有服务器能够访问互联网,以便下载安装包。

部署步骤

1、安装Keepalived

在所有服务器上安装Keepalived,可以使用以下命令:

yum install keepalived -y

2、配置Keepalived

在主服务器上编辑Keepalived配置文件/etc/keepalived/keepalived.conf,添加以下内容:

! Configuration File for keepalived
global_defs {
   router_id LVS_DEVEL
}
vrrp_instance VI_1 {
    state MASTER
    interface eth0
    virtual_router_id 51
    priority 100
    advert_int 1
    authentication {
        auth_type PASS
        auth_pass 1111
    }
    virtual_ipaddress {
        192.168.1.100
    }
}
virtual_server 192.168.1.100 80 {
    delay_loop 6
    lb_kind NAT
    persistence_timeout 50
    protocol TCP
    real_server 192.168.1.101 80 {
        weight 1
    }
    real_server 192.168.1.102 80 {
        weight 1
    }
}

在备用服务器上,将state MASTER修改为state BACKUP,并适当调整priority值。

3、启动Keepalived

在所有服务器上启动Keepalived服务:

systemctl start keepalived

4、检查Keepalived状态

使用以下命令检查Keepalived状态:

ip a

在主服务器上,应该能看到虚拟IP地址(192.168.1.100)已经绑定到eth0接口上,在备用服务器上,虚拟IP地址不应该出现。

5、测试高可用性

关闭主服务器上的Keepalived服务,观察备用服务器是否能够接管虚拟IP地址,并确保业务不受影响。

注意事项

1、确保所有服务器的时间同步,可以使用NTP服务。

2、配置防火墙规则,确保Keepalived能够正常通信。

3、根据实际业务需求,调整Keepalived的配置参数。

4、定期检查Keepalived日志,及时发现并解决问题。

通过以上步骤,我们可以实现基于Keepalived的高可用集群部署,Keepalived的配置简单,易于管理,能够有效提高系统的稳定性和可靠性,在业务日益复杂的今天,掌握高可用集群部署技术对于保障业务连续性具有重要意义。

以下为50个中文相关关键词:

Keepalived, 高可用, 集群部署, VRRP, 虚拟路由器, 网络冗余, 系统稳定性, 业务连续性, Linux, CentOS, 硬件环境, 软件环境, 网络环境, 安装Keepalived, 配置Keepalived, 启动Keepalived, Keepalived状态, 虚拟IP地址, 备用服务器, 高可用性测试, 时间同步, 防火墙规则, 配置参数, 日志检查, 系统管理, 业务保障, 网络服务, 负载均衡, 数据库, Web服务器, 文件服务器, 集群架构, 容错机制, 备份方案, 灾难恢复, 网络故障, 系统监控, 性能优化, 业务扩展, 资源共享, 虚拟化技术, 云计算, 大数据, 分布式系统, 网络安全, 数据保护, 高性能计算, 服务器负载, 高并发处理, 业务高峰, 系统维护, 网络规划。

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

keepalived高可用集群部署:高可用集群架构

原文链接:,转发请注明来源!